you want to turn it to the rear of the car to remove it. when the body is crushed and has holes, it no longer works well as part of the removal. you now want to get large channel lock pliers, or a filter wrench that has pliers like jaw, and crab the filter high, near the top where it mounts to the engine, as that is the only place left with any structure.

When in doubt about something like this.. orient yourself so you are looking at the end of the item. Then move your hand counter clockwise and follow that over to the item.

In this case, lay on the ground looking at the sky. Turn your hand counter clockwise and follow that to the car.
 


I did this once also. Its easy to get confused when the orientation of the things your loosening / tightening changes.
